Brady misses practice for first time this season with foot injury
FOXBOROUGH -- Patriots quarterback Tom Brady did not participate in practice today because of a foot injury, according to the team's practice report released moments ago.
Foot and right shoulder are listed by Brady's name on the injury report. But the foot injury is believed to be what kept Brady out of practice, considering he is often listed on the report for his right shoulder.
This is the first time Brady has missed a practice because of injury since returning from a torn anterior cruciate ligament suffered in the 2008 season. Aside from missing most of the '08 season, Brady never has missed a game since becoming the starter in 2001.
